FUEL INJECTION (FUEL SYSTEMS)
18.Engine Control Module (ECM)
A: REMOVAL
1) Disconnect the ground cable from battery.
2) Remove the lower inner trim of passenger's
side. <Ref. to EI-55, REMOVAL, Lower Inner
Trim.>
3) Turn over the floor mat of passenger's seat.
4) Remove the protect cover.
5) Remove the nuts and bolts which hold the ECM
to the bracket.
6) Disconnect the ECM connectors, and take out
the ECM.

B: INSTALLATION
Install in the reverse order of removal.
CAUTION:
When the ECM of model with immobilizer has
been replaced, be sure to perform the registra-
tion of immobilizer system. (Refer to "PC appli-
cation help for Subaru Select Monitor".)
NOTE:
When replacing the ECM, be careful not to use the
wrong spec. ECM to avoid any damage on the fuel
injection system.
Tightening torque:
7.5 N·m (0.8 kgf-m, 5.5 ft-lb)
